    The Elloree Bed and Breakfast is an elegant "Old South" colonial built by M.E.Rickenbaker in 1906. It is located halfway between Charleston and Columbia in the heart of golf and fishing country, just off Old Highway 6 in charming Elloree, South Carolina. Picturesque views from every room invite you to stroll the almost three acres of finely manicured landscaping. You may choose to relax on the wicker rockers on either the upper or lower veranda, or one of the park benches in the yard. Romantic getaways are our specialty. "Elegant Southern Comfort" is our motto! During the warmer months, an in-ground pool may be enjoyed by guests. A full country breakfast is served daily in our beautiful dining room featuring chandeliers, period furiture and uncommon antique decorations.
